  • Patent number: 4371321
    Abstract: The invention relates to a metering pump for liquid and gaseous media, which is provided with a deformable tube for the medium to be conveyed. The pump casing accommodates a rotating member which squeezes the tube against an inside surface in the pump casing. The tube is guided around the rotating member constituting a main eccentric, through a looping angle of 360.degree.. A secondary eccentric, the diameter of which is smaller than the diameter of the main eccentric, is mounted on the shaft of the main eccentric. The main eccentric is a ball bearing, the outer race of which clings to the tube by surface adhesion during rotation of the shaft. The ball bearing is rotated with the rotating shaft, while the outer race performs a radial reciprocating motion, thus avoiding any flexing of the tube, which is merely cyclically compressed and released again.

  • Patent number: 4332534
    Abstract: A membrane pump comprising a housing having an inner cylindrical surface, an annular member in the housing and having an outer surface defining with the inner surface of the housing a working space. A hollow rolling piston is arranged in the interior of said annular membrane. An eccentric drive including an arm fixed at one end to a drive shaft carries at its other end a roller engaging the inner surface of the rolling piston for rotating the latter about its axis while pressing the outer surface thereof against the inner surface of the membrane, whereby the outer surface of the membrane is pressed at a revolving sealing region against the inner surface of the housing.

  • Patent number: 3963386
    Abstract: A fluid pressure motor having a plurality of independent, freely distortable pressure chambers connected together in the form of a multi-lobed rosette shaped structure arranged between two rotatable supporting plates inclined at an angle to each other. The chambers are elastically deformable by the fluid pressure and there are at least two rosette shaped structures superimposed between the rotating support plates with adjacent chambers in each of the rosettes being in fluid communication with each other and with a control system for introducing a fluid pressure medium into the chambers sequentially and expelling it after the chambers have attained maximum volume.

  • Patent number: 3951576
    Abstract: The rotation of a helix within a deformable tube which is located within and attached by the ends to a pump casing of circular cross section causes fluid to flow between the tube and pump casing when the tube contains at least one longitudinal rib continuously connected to the pump casing. Changes in the cross sectional area of the pump casing and changes in the configuration of the helix permits additional fluid to be drawn into the fluid stream or a portion of such fluid to be discharged from the space between the deformable tube and the pump casing at the transitions in cross sectional areas of the pump casing or changes in configuration of the helix.
